Israel Vibration

Israel Vibration is a reggae band.

The trio had a decisive effect with its harmony and singing stressed roots reggae music. As so often with Jamaican musicians, is also the story of Cecil " Skelly " Spence, Lascelle " Wiss " Bulgin and Albert " Apple " Craig rather sadder nature. Even in his early childhood ill all three polio ( infantile paralysis ). Due to the difficult financial situation of their families, they were taken to Kingston from "Mona Rehabilitation Center " where they first met.

Although polio in only one percent of all cases leads to paralysis, hit it, so they have all three to still suffer a disability. The greatest consolation in this case is the belief in God for them. All three members of Israel Vibration are devout Rastafarians, which is particularly evident in their lyrics. Their faith, coupled with the rasta typical exterior meant that the trio had to leave the "Mona Rehabilitation Center".

Their first album, " Same Song " was released in 1976 and was nearly 100,000 copies sold. A year later, Israel Vibration was a member of the "Twelve Tribes of Israel." In 1983, the group split up initially to start in the U.S., with better medical care, solo careers. 1988, however it was conducted by Dr. Dread, founder of " RAS Records " together again, as each of the three independently asked him to record a solo album. This continues to today second creative period of the trio appeared including " Strength Of My Life ," " Live Again " and "Jericho".

Their album Reggae Knights was nominated in 2012 in the category Best Reggae Album at the Grammy Awards.
